Mehdi Naderi Soorki is a scholar working on Electrical and Electronic Engineering, Computer Networks and Communications and Aerospace Engineering. According to data from OpenAlex, Mehdi Naderi Soorki has authored 25 papers receiving a total of 464 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 22 papers in Electrical and Electronic Engineering, 10 papers in Computer Networks and Communications and 6 papers in Aerospace Engineering. Recurrent topics in Mehdi Naderi Soorki’s work include Advanced MIMO Systems Optimization (10 papers), Advanced Wireless Communication Technologies (7 papers) and Millimeter-Wave Propagation and Modeling (6 papers). Mehdi Naderi Soorki is often cited by papers focused on Advanced MIMO Systems Optimization (10 papers), Advanced Wireless Communication Technologies (7 papers) and Millimeter-Wave Propagation and Modeling (6 papers). Mehdi Naderi Soorki collaborates with scholars based in Iran, United States and Finland. Mehdi Naderi Soorki's co-authors include Walid Saad, Mehdi Bennis, Christina Chaccour, Petar Popovski, Mérouane Debbah, Mohammad Hossein Manshaei, Hossein Saidi, Habib Rostami, Mohammad Mozaffari and Behrouz Maham and has published in prestigious journals such as Scientific Reports, IEEE Communications Surveys & Tutorials and IEEE Access.
